About Arbind Prasad

Arbind Prasad is a scholar working on Biomedical Engineering, Surgery, Mechanical Engineering, Biomaterials and Materials Chemistry, having authored 27 papers that have together received 510 indexed citations. Recurring topics across this work include Bone Tissue Engineering Materials (9 papers), Orthopaedic implants and arthroplasty (6 papers), biodegradable polymer synthesis and properties (5 papers), Graphene and Nanomaterials Applications (3 papers), Advanced machining processes and optimization (2 papers), Advanced materials and composites (2 papers), Advanced Machining and Optimization Techniques (2 papers) and Additive Manufacturing and 3D Printing Technologies (2 papers). The work is most often cited by research in Biomaterials (212 citations), Biomedical Engineering (282 citations), Automotive Engineering (71 citations), Orthodontics (21 citations) and Oral Surgery (26 citations). Arbind Prasad has collaborated with scholars based in India, United Kingdom and South Korea. Frequent co-authors include Mamilla Ravi Sankar, Vimal Katiyar, Vimal Katiyar, Ashwani Kumar, Sushil Kumar Verma, Siddharth Mohan Bhasney, Sonika Sonika, Sachin Kumar, Arvind Gupta and Neha Mulchandani. Their work appears in journals such as Journal of Manufacturing Processes, Journal of Applied Polymer Science, Materials Advances, Nanomedicine and Journal of Polymer Research.
